For the Gardener:
Angel Earrings fuchsias bring the beauty of fuchsias to hot weather gardens. Semi-shade to full shade is preferred. Both the Dainty and Cascading Angel Earrings fuchsias have purple-blue center petals and a pink outer skirt.
The Dainty Angel Earrings fuchsia will produce a round, compact plant about one foot in height. It is perfect as a border planting in a bed or in a pot.
Cascading Angel Earrings fuchsia is a larger plant that arches gracefully over containers and baskets.
For the Commercial Grower:
Unshaded greenhouse in fall, winter and spring. Some shading may be desired in summer months, depending upon greenhouse cover and/or location.
64F (18C) night, 68F (20C) cloudy day, 78F (26C) bright day.
Bright daylight is best. Supplemental high intensity lighting is recommended on cloudy days, or to extend the day length.
1200 - 1500 parts per million of CO2 is recommended.
